Explanation:

According to geographical coordinates and related information, when the latitude is lower, that is closer to the equator the temperature becomes warmer. While the far away from the equator the latitude is the temperature decreases.

Similarly, the water bodies have a relative effect that is considered little or less severe on the temperature throughout any of the seasonal period or day and night.
